Breaking: LASU professor, Lai Oso, dies in auto crash

A Nigerian communication scholar and professor at the Faculty of Communication and Media Studies (FCMS), Lagos State University (LASU), Prof. Lai Oso, is dead.

It was gathered that Oso died in an auto crash on his way back to Lagos from Delta State University (DELSU), Abaraka, where he reportedly went to serve as an external examiner, on Saturday evening.

Confirming the incident, one of the professor’s colleagues and a senior lecturer in LASU, Omolade Atofojomi, said: “From God we came to him we will return but this is so painful.”
